首页文章正文

float赋值规则,double赋值给float

float强制转换int 2023-11-28 17:44 385 墨鱼
float强制转换int

float赋值规则,double赋值给float

float赋值规则,double赋值给float

float赋值float赋值1.如果指定一个浮点数字,则必须在末尾添加fat。例如:floata=52.12f;2.如果不addit,则需要使用caster。例如:floata=(float)52.12; 3.如果指定一个整数。 4.在赋值语句中,在将右边的值赋给左边的变量之前=,必须先将右边的值的数据类型转换为左边的变量的数据类型。

>ω< 给floatordouble赋值时,请注意以下几点:1.注意赋值初始值,如果是0,则赋值0.0,而不是0,因为这样比较规范,比如要赋值3,就赋值3.0; 2.参与运算并把结果从低到高赋值。转换顺序为:char,short-int-unsigned-long-doublefloat-double

includeintmain(){1.1;//这种浮点常量,其默认类型为doublefloatf1=1.1f;//使用lowercaseffloatf2=1.1F;//使用uppercaseFprintf("%f\t%f\n",f1,f2)不同类型值的赋值规则​​1.当浮点数据被赋值给整数变量时, 浮点数的小数部分被丢弃。 否则,整数以浮点数的形式存储在变量中。 2.将double类型赋值给float类型,并截取前7位。

⊙ω⊙ floatbe4=3.2;错误:不兼容类型:doubletofloat转换可能会造成损失floatbe4=3.2;强制类型转换可以通过三种形式进行offloat赋值:floatbe4=(float)3.2;floatjave数据类型float正确赋值1.前言float是单精度浮点类型,有8位有效数字,占用机器内存4个字节【double是双精度浮点类型,有16位有效数字,占用机器内存8个字节

通过=将新数据值分配给数组元素month_days[1]。 Month_days[下标]不仅可以访问某个下标的数组元素,还可以通过=直接修改数据值。 9.7数据复制将一个数组中的所有数据复制到另一个1这里,将"3.4"赋给float类型变量x。如果不添加F,系统将默认将分配的数字视为double类型1,然后将此double类型值赋给float类型,因此精度会降低。

后台-插件-广告管理-内容页尾部广告(手机)

标签: double赋值给float

发表评论

评论列表

黑豹加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号